OU men’s basketball landed a portal pickup late into transfer season Thursday afternoon in former SMU guard BJ Edwards.

Edwards averaged 12.7 points, 5.9 rebounds and 4.9 assists over 28 games with the Mustangs this past season. Though his collegiate career seemed finished, Edwards was granted a fifth year of eligibility after a court hearing in Tennessee.

The senior began his career at Tennessee before transferring to SMU following his freshman season. Now, the veteran guard brings experience to Norman, continuing a theme of Porter Moser’s offseason roster construction.

Edwards joins fellow fifth-year senior guard Pop Isaacs, highly touted junior forward Khani Rooths, senior guard Tyler Hendricks and junior Yaak Yaak as part of the Sooners’ 2026 transfer class.

The veteran transfer group will look to get OU back on track after a 21-16 campaign that saw the Sooners narrowly miss March Madness as the first team left out of the field for the second consecutive season.
